|
ORA-01555: snapshot too old: rollback segment number 7 with name to small
|
|||
---|---|---|---|
#18+
Хочу откатить на 10 часов назад Код: plsql 1.
; Пошарил на форумах, пишут нужно создать сегмент. Код: plsql 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16.
Код: plsql 1.
1). dba_rollback_segs не показывает созданный сегмент. 2). Какой размер и на какой параметер нужно задать чтобы сегмент сохранял дату на откат примерно на 2 дня ? Код: xml 1. 2. 3. 4. 5.
Спасибо.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2020, 20:58 |
|
ORA-01555: snapshot too old: rollback segment number 7 with name to small
|
|||
---|---|---|---|
#18+
DB - 12.2.0.1 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2020, 21:08 |
|
ORA-01555: snapshot too old: rollback segment number 7 with name to small
|
|||
---|---|---|---|
#18+
Goofy122 DB - 12.2.0.1 Не понял, а UNDO где? Или все по старинке, как на 7.3, работаете? 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2020, 21:36 |
|
ORA-01555: snapshot too old: rollback segment number 7 with name to small
|
|||
---|---|---|---|
#18+
flexgen Goofy122 DB - 12.2.0.1 Не понял, а UNDO где? Или все по старинке, как на 7.3, работаете? Извиняюсь CREATE PUBLIC ROLLBACK SEGMENT SEGS_01 TABLESPACE UNDOTBS1 STORAGE ( INITIAL 50K NEXT 50K OPTIMAL 750K MINEXTENTS 15 MAXEXTENTS 100 ); Вы это имели ввиду ? Если я поставлю unto retention на 25000 сохранится ли откат на 7 часов примерно ? 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2020, 21:44 |
|
ORA-01555: snapshot too old: rollback segment number 7 with name to small
|
|||
---|---|---|---|
#18+
Goofy122, Я имел ввиду имеется ли в наличии tablespace UNDOTBS, или база создана без него? Если UNDO имеется то создавать rollback segment не нужно. Думаю, тебе сюда - Managing Undo 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2020, 22:04 |
|
ORA-01555: snapshot too old: rollback segment number 7 with name to small
|
|||
---|---|---|---|
#18+
flexgen Goofy122, Я имел ввиду имеется ли в наличии tablespace UNDOTBS, или база создана без него? Если UNDO имеется то создавать rollback segment не нужно. Думаю, тебе сюда - Managing Undo Прочитать-то прочитал , как опытный в этом деле скажите пжт. Если я поставлю unto retention на 25000 сохранится ли откат на 7 часов примерно ? UNDOTBS настроен на 32 ГБ ... |
|||
:
Нравится:
Не нравится:
|
|||
21.01.2020, 22:41 |
|
ORA-01555: snapshot too old: rollback segment number 7 with name to small
|
|||
---|---|---|---|
#18+
Goofy122 Хочу откатить на 10 часов назад [src PLSQL] ... 2). Какой размер и на какой параметер нужно задать чтобы сегмент сохранял дату на откат примерно на 2 дня ? Размер зависит исключительно от того, как интенсивно вы меняете данные в базе. Вот сколько undo у вас обычно генериться за два дня, вот такой размер доступного undo и нужно иметь. И параметр undo_retention поставьте в желаемое значение. v$undostat вам в помощь. Если вам вот прямо ОЧЕНЬ-ОЧЕНЬ нужно гарантировать откат что бы не произошло, сделайте undo с retention guarantee. В этом случае, если место в undo на задекларированное время не хватит, всё само сразу и откатится... И, это. Забудьте про отдельные сегменты отката... ... |
|||
:
Нравится:
Не нравится:
|
|||
22.01.2020, 02:06 |
|
ORA-01555: snapshot too old: rollback segment number 7 with name to small
|
|||
---|---|---|---|
#18+
проходил мимо... Goofy122 Хочу откатить на 10 часов назад [src PLSQL] ... 2). Какой размер и на какой параметер нужно задать чтобы сегмент сохранял дату на откат примерно на 2 дня ? Размер зависит исключительно от того, как интенсивно вы меняете данные в базе. Вот сколько undo у вас обычно генериться за два дня, вот такой размер доступного undo и нужно иметь. И параметр undo_retention поставьте в желаемое значение. v$undostat вам в помощь. Если вам вот прямо ОЧЕНЬ-ОЧЕНЬ нужно гарантировать откат что бы не произошло, сделайте undo с retention guarantee. В этом случае, если место в undo на задекларированное время не хватит, всё само сразу и откатится... И, это. Забудьте про отдельные сегменты отката... Спасибо большое вам за подробную информацию, помогли очень ... |
|||
:
Нравится:
Не нравится:
|
|||
22.01.2020, 19:41 |
|
|
start [/forum/topic.php?fid=52&fpage=55&tid=1881635]: |
0ms |
get settings: |
10ms |
get forum list: |
12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
34ms |
get topic data: |
12ms |
get forum data: |
3ms |
get page messages: |
47ms |
get tp. blocked users: |
2ms |
others: | 292ms |
total: | 420ms |
0 / 0 |